TERENCE T. EVANS, Circuit Judge. Vivian Smart is a tree surgeon. Before assuming that position she was in a three-year tree surgeon training program. In this suit she claims that early in the training program she was subjected to retaliation by her employer, Ball State University, in response to a sex discrimination charge she previously filed with the EEOC.
